一、AI模型聚合平台的技术演进背景
随着生成式AI技术的爆发式增长,主流云服务商已推出超过50种大语言模型,涵盖通用对话、代码生成、多模态理解等垂直领域。开发者在构建AI应用时面临三大核心挑战:
- 模型选择困境:不同模型在特定场景下性能差异显著,例如某开源模型在数学推理任务上表现优异,而另一模型在长文本生成方面更具优势;
- 集成成本高企:每个模型需单独对接API、处理鉴权、适配数据格式,导致开发周期延长30%以上;
- 资源利用低效:多模型并行运行时,缺乏动态调度机制导致GPU资源闲置率高达40%。
在此背景下,AI模型聚合平台应运而生,其核心价值在于通过抽象化层屏蔽底层模型差异,提供标准化的开发接口与智能化的资源管理方案。
二、OpenRouter平台架构设计解析
2.1 统一模型接入层
平台采用插件化架构设计,通过定义标准化的模型接口协议(Model Interface Specification),支持快速接入各类AI模型。接入流程包含三个关键步骤:
- 协议适配:将模型原生API转换为统一格式,例如将某模型的
generate_text方法映射为标准inference(prompt, parameters)接口; - 性能封装:为每个模型添加缓存层、批处理模块和异步调用支持,典型案例显示批处理可使QPS提升5-8倍;
- 元数据管理:自动采集模型版本、支持语言、最大上下文长度等20余项参数,构建模型能力知识图谱。
# 示例:模型插件基类定义class ModelPlugin:def __init__(self, config):self.max_tokens = config.get('max_tokens')self.supported_languages = config.get('languages')async def inference(self, prompt: str, params: dict) -> dict:raise NotImplementedError
2.2 智能路由引擎
路由引擎是平台的核心调度中枢,其决策逻辑基于多维度评估体系:
- 成本优先策略:根据模型调用单价、响应时间、成功率构建成本函数,例如:
Cost = (API_Price × Tokens) + (Latency × Penalty_Factor)
- 质量感知路由:通过实时监控各模型的输出质量指标(如BLEU分数、事实准确性),在对话类场景中动态切换高评分模型;
- 容灾降级机制:当主选模型出现故障时,自动切换至备选模型并触发告警,某金融客户案例显示该机制将系统可用性提升至99.95%。
实验数据显示,智能路由可使平均响应时间降低35%,同时将单位请求成本优化22%。
2.3 开发者工具链
平台提供完整的全生命周期管理工具:
- 可视化调试台:支持对比不同模型的输出结果,内置Prompt工程优化建议,某电商团队通过该工具将商品描述生成效率提升40%;
- 性能分析面板:实时展示各模型的QPS、错误率、资源占用率等10余项指标,帮助快速定位性能瓶颈;
- 自动化测试框架:集成200+标准测试用例,覆盖数学计算、逻辑推理、多轮对话等典型场景,生成详细的模型能力评估报告。
三、关键技术实现深度剖析
3.1 统一API设计原则
平台遵循RESTful与gRPC双协议设计,关键设计决策包括:
- 请求标准化:将复杂参数封装为
ModelRequest对象,包含prompt、temperature、max_tokens等15个通用字段; - 响应结构化:定义
ModelResponse标准格式,强制包含confidence_score、source_model等元数据字段; - 版本控制机制:通过API网关实现接口版本兼容,确保存量应用在模型升级时无需修改代码。
# 示例:统一API请求规范POST /v1/inferenceContent-Type: application/json{"model": "auto", # 支持自动路由"prompt": "解释量子计算的基本原理","parameters": {"temperature": 0.7,"max_tokens": 500}}
3.2 性能优化实践
针对AI推理场景的特殊性,平台实施了多层次优化:
- 连接池管理:维护长连接池减少TCP握手开销,某测试显示该优化使QPS提升120%;
- 异步批处理:将多个小请求合并为批量请求,在保持低延迟的同时提高GPU利用率;
- 边缘计算部署:通过CDN节点缓存热门模型,使华南地区用户平均延迟降低至80ms以内。
3.3 安全合规体系
平台构建了四层安全防护:
- 数据加密:传输层采用TLS 1.3,存储层实施AES-256加密;
- 内容过滤:集成敏感词检测与PII识别模块,符合GDPR等数据保护法规;
- 审计日志:完整记录所有API调用信息,支持6个月内的操作追溯;
- 访问控制:基于RBAC模型实现细粒度权限管理,最小权限原则确保数据安全。
四、典型应用场景与实施路径
4.1 智能客服系统构建
某银行通过平台实现多模型协同:
- 意图识别:使用某高性能模型进行快速分类;
- 知识检索:调用向量数据库模型获取相关文档;
- 对话生成:采用某创意写作模型生成人性化回复。
该方案使问题解决率提升25%,人力成本降低40%。
4.2 代码辅助开发
开发者可配置多模型流水线:
- 代码补全:优先使用某代码专用模型;
- 单元测试生成:切换至某逻辑推理模型;
- 安全扫描:调用某静态分析模型。
某团队实践显示,该模式使开发效率提升60%,缺陷率下降33%。
4.3 多模态内容生产
平台支持文本、图像、音频的联合处理:
- 文案生成:使用文本模型创作广告语;
- 配图生成:调用图像模型生成视觉素材;
- 语音合成:通过TTS模型转换为语音。
某媒体公司通过该方案将内容生产周期从72小时缩短至8小时。
五、未来技术演进方向
平台将持续深化三大技术领域:
- 模型联邦学习:构建去中心化的模型训练框架,支持跨组织数据协作;
- 自适应路由算法:引入强化学习机制,实现动态环境下的最优调度;
- 边缘智能部署:开发轻量化推理引擎,支持在IoT设备上运行模型片段。
随着AI技术的持续演进,模型聚合平台将成为企业智能化转型的关键基础设施。通过标准化接口、智能化调度和全链路工具支持,开发者可专注于业务创新,而无需陷入底层技术细节的泥潭。这种技术范式的转变,正在重新定义AI应用的开发范式与价值分配逻辑。